A decline in Apple Inc. (AAPL) shares has drawn investor attention to exchange-traded funds carrying the highest concentration of Apple exposure. Funds with the largest Apple weighting track the stock's price moves with little offset from other holdings, making the selloff a direct test of single-name concentration risk.

Concentration and price sensitivity

An ETF's sensitivity to any individual stock scales with that stock's weight in the portfolio. The higher Apple's allocation within a given fund, the more closely its net asset value follows AAPL's daily price action. A decline in Apple shares hits those products hardest, and broadly diversified products provide the most insulation.

Where investor focus is landing

The selloff is drawing attention to precisely which ETFs carry Apple most heavily in their portfolios. Those funds sit at the top of the single-name exposure range, with little in the rest of the portfolio to absorb a move in the underlying stock. Investors examining ETF holdings during a period of Apple weakness face a straightforward exercise: the highest-concentration products are the ones most directly in the line of the decline.
